Output 6608cc51af3101e307bdf0be016079b1531e40ada09a1a8c725e3f396b0109f0:1

value
24252869
script pubkey
OP_0 OP_PUSHBYTES_20 7a0e3f36040e8c5eae614cc576fc91c10bf0c328
address
bc1q0g8r7dsyp6x9atnpfnzhdly3cy9lpsegycd0ju
transaction
6608cc51af3101e307bdf0be016079b1531e40ada09a1a8c725e3f396b0109f0